The newly forming Symbiosis Evolution research group ( http://www.symbioses.pl ) at the Institute of Environmental Sciences of Jagiellonian University ( http://www.eko.uj.edu.pl ) is looking to hire a Postdoctoral Researcher. This is a full-time, up to 48-month position funded by the Polish National Agency for Academic Exchange (NAWA) project Insect Microbiomics, available from 1 July 2019.

The Postdoc will join an active, collaborative team aiming to describe the broad patterns of the microbial diversity across insects, and the dynamics of the insect microbiomes across space and time. That will be done using high-throughput next-generation sequencing (NGS), in close collaboration with a massive insect biodiversity project, Insect Biome Atlas ( https://insectbiomeatlas.com ) that would provide large numbers of specimens.

The Postdoc will initially focus on the development of protocols for high-throughput, automated next-generation sequencing library preparation in the context of microbiome studies, as well as bioinformatic pipelines for the analysis of the resulting data. Later, they will lead the microbiome characterization in large collections of insects from Sweden, Madagascar and/or Greenland.
